Hello Python :) 补充数据类型:set(简单记忆:不允许重复的列表) s = set() #创建空集合 s.add(11) s.add(11) for s1 in s : print(s1) #仅仅输出一个11 细节: 创建set集合的时候,也可以接受元组、字符串、列表等可迭代对象。 ...
分类:
编程语言 时间:
2016-07-29 21:06:37
阅读次数:
160
#!/bin/sh
#功能:从ip列表中找到具体某个ip的所有访问日志并生成对应的文件
#
#
mkdirhandle
>com.ip.txt
functionhandle(){
#echo"egrep"$1"0602.log>handle/$n.txt"
egrep"$1"0602.log>handle/$1.txt
time=`wc-lhandle/$n.txt|awk‘{print$1}‘`
mvhandle/$1.txthandl..
分类:
其他好文 时间:
2016-07-29 19:41:42
阅读次数:
157
!/usr/bin/python3
#-*-coding:utf-8-*-
defa(max):
n=0
whilen<max:
c=[‘aa‘,‘bb‘,‘cc‘,‘dd‘,‘rr‘,‘ff‘]
print‘yield前面‘,n
yieldc[n]
print‘yield后面‘,n
n+=1
foriina(6):
print"for循环print:",i
print‘--‘*25执行过程:通过结果可以看出:首先for循环调用函数,执行函..
分类:
编程语言 时间:
2016-07-29 19:40:46
阅读次数:
150
#!/usr/bin/envpython
#coding:utf-8
"""
装饰器实例拆解
"""
deflogin00(func):
print(‘00请通过验证用户!‘)
returnfunc
deftv00(name):
print(‘00你的用户是:%s‘%name)
#装饰器的精简工作原理解释:
tv=login00(tv00)#返回tv函数的对象,赋值给tv
tv(‘yh00‘)#调用执..
分类:
编程语言 时间:
2016-07-29 19:37:42
阅读次数:
191
import time def tm(*arg, **kwargs): def wrap_fun(fun): def wrap_arg(*arg, **kwargs): print time.time() fun(*arg, **kwargs) print time.time() return wr ...
分类:
其他好文 时间:
2016-07-29 19:06:32
阅读次数:
153
Linux中find命令常见用法示例: #-print 将查找到的文件输出到标准输出#-exec command {} \; 将查到的文件执行command操作,{} 和 \;之间有空格#-ok 和-exec相同,只不过在操作前要询用户-name filename #查找名为filename的文件- ...
分类:
系统相关 时间:
2016-07-29 18:38:09
阅读次数:
262
函数: enumerate(iterable, start=0) 返回一个枚举类型 复制代码 enumerate(iterable, start=0) 返回一个枚举类型 代码: >>> for i,j in enumerate(('a','b','c')): print(i,j) 0 a 1 b 2 ...
分类:
编程语言 时间:
2016-07-29 18:38:01
阅读次数:
154
1.查看TCP连接状态 1 2 3 4 5 6 netstat -nat | awk 'NR>2{print $6}' | sort |uniq -c | sort -rn netstat -n | awk '/^tcp/ {++S[$NF]};END {for(a in S) print a, S ...
分类:
Web程序 时间:
2016-07-29 18:29:18
阅读次数:
256
下面是摘抄自博主 吊儿郎当 的一篇关于hash的解释,觉得说的很有道理,摘抄下来方便自己可以随时复习,巩固!! 1.#的含义 #代表网页中的一个位置。其右面的字符,就是该位置的标识符。如: 就代表网页index.html的print位置。浏览器读取这个URL后,会自动将print位置滚动至可视区域。 ...
分类:
其他好文 时间:
2016-07-28 16:21:47
阅读次数:
194
首先 做好备份, 脚本语句在测试环境下 测试一遍。。 通过文件的inode号删除文件 先用ls -i 找出要删除文件的inode 号 ls -i |grep xxxxxx|awk '{print $2}'|xargs -i rm -f {} xxxxxx为文件的 inode 号 通过文件大小删除文件 ...
分类:
系统相关 时间:
2016-07-28 16:18:20
阅读次数:
280